Biography
Moshe "Mauritz" Stiller was born on July 17, 1883, in Helsinki, Finland. A director, writer, and actor, he began his artistic career in the theatre, performing as an actor at the age of 16. Between 1899 and 1916, he portrayed 87 roles and directed 16 productions from 1911 to 1928. In 1912, along with Viktor Sjöström (a director, actor, and writer), he was recruited as a director and actor by Charles Magnusson at AB Svenska Biografteatern to work in the Swedish film industry. Stiller's films were immediately successful, and in his first year alone, he directed six feature films. "Herr Arnes pengar" (1919), "Erotikon" (1920), and "Gösta Berlings saga" (1923) are considered three major milestones in Swedish film production. In "Gösta Berlings saga," Greta Garbo, at 18 years old, made her first major film appearance. Garbo and Stiller became close friends and allies. Stiller introduced Garbo to the German audience in 1925, before the two traveled to the USA to make "The Temptress" for Paramount/Irving Thalberg in 1926. From 1912 to 1927, Stiller directed 51 feature films and appeared as an actor in seven productions. He died on November 8, 1928, at 1:05 am in Stockholm, after undergoing numerous surgeries; an abscess of the lung ended the life of the artist.
